This makes a change to the debug scripts to make it easier for both users and those tending to the issue tracker by setting Blender's temporary directory location to the debug logs location The is necessary because while the debug output and the system information file go to %temp%\blender\debug_logs, the crash text file does not. We then have to spend additional time asking the user to go fetch it from the other location. Now the crash file ends up in the same place.
